Subject: [PATCH 09/10] dts: versatile: add clock tree
Date: Tue, 20 May 2014 16:09:35 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1400620176-7239-10-git-send-email-robherring2@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1400620176-7239-1-git-send-email-robherring2-Re5JQEeQqe8AvxtiuMwx3w@public.gmane.org>
From: Rob Herring <robh-DgEjT+Ai2ygdnm+yROfE0A@public.gmane.org>
The versatile dts is missing any clock data. Add the clocks.
It is not clear from the documentation where pclk comes from, so for
now it is a dummy clock which is sufficient for things to work.

ar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-ab.dts | 74 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-pb.dts | 10 ++++++
2 files changed, 84 insertions(+)
di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-ab.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-ab.dts
index e4cba63..37e01b4 100644
---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-ab.dts
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/versatile-ab.dts
@@ -19,6 +19,40 @@
reg = <0x0 0x08000000>;
};
+ core-module@10000000 {
+ compatible = "arm,core-module-versatile";
+ reg = <0x10000000 0x200>;
+
+ osc24M: oscillator@24M {
+ #clock-cells = <0>;
+ compatible = "fixed-clock";
+ clock-frequency = <24000000>;
+ };
+
+ /* OSC1 on AB, OSC4 on PB */
+ osc1: cm_aux_osc@24M {
+ #clock-cells = <0>;
+ compatible = "arm,versatile-cm-auxosc";
+ clocks = <&osc24M>;
+ };
+
+ /* The timer clock is the 24 MHz oscillator divided to 1MHz */
+ timclk: timclk@1M {
+ #clock-cells = <0>;
+ compatible = "fixed-factor-clock";
+ clock-div = <24>;
+ clock-mult = <1>;
+ clocks = <&osc24M>;
+ };
+
+ /* Actually hclk ? */
+ pclk: pclk@0 {
+ #clock-cells = <0>;
+ compatible = "fixed-clock";
+ clock-frequency = <0>;
+ };
+ };
